一、导言
本文针对老版 TPWallet(以下简称 TPWallet)进行全面分析,聚焦代码审计、全球化数字生态、发展策略、智能化数据应用、可追溯性与矿池相关问题,提出技术与运营建议,帮助产品安全升级与可持续发展。
二、代码审计要点
1. 密钥与签名:检查 BIP39/BIP44 实现、助记词生成的熵来源、私钥在内存与持久化中的加密与销毁策略;评估是否使用硬件隔离(Secure Enclave、TPM)或软件加固。
2. 依赖与漏洞:静态分析第三方库(Crypto、网络库、WebView、JS 引擎)版本与已知 CVE;启用依赖锁定与 SBOM(软件物料清单)。
3. 交易构建与验证:重放攻击、签名可塑性、链间手续费估算、安全的变更签名格式、交易构造边界检查。
4. 通信与后端:HTTPS/TLS 配置、证书钉扎、API 权限、速率限制、认证与令牌管理、日志脱敏。
5. 更新与供给链:远程更新签名校验、CI/CD 安全、构建环境隔离、代码审计与再验证机制。
三、全球化数字生态考量

1. 多链与多资产支持:设计抽象化链适配器、保持一致的钱包接口、跨链桥风控。
2. 合规与监管:针对不同司法辖区的 KYC/AML、税务上链方案、数据主权与 GDPR 相容性。

3. 本地化与支付网络:多语言、时间/货币格式、本地法币通道(支付网关、第三方合规合作)。
4. 社区与生态合作:开源 SDK、开发者支持、跨境合作伙伴、交易所与钱包互操作性。
四、发展策略(产品与商业)
1. 模块化演进:保持向后兼容的分阶段迁移(老数据迁移工具、兼容层)。
2. 安全为先:常态化代码审计、赏金计划、官方签名发布与第三方审计公示。
3. 商业化路径:B2B SDK、白标服务、与托管/非托管服务并行、增值服务(法币入口、债券/理财)。
4. 社区驱动:文档、测试网络、开源治理与透明路线图提升信任。
五、智能化数据应用
1. 风控与反欺诈:基于行为与链上数据的 ML 风险评分、异常交易检测、实时风控策略自动下发。
2. 用户画像与体验:弱化操作成本的推荐引擎、智能费率建议、自动化 GAS 优化与批处理签名。
3. 隐私保护的智能化:采用差分隐私、联邦学习在保障隐私下训练模型,避免将敏感数据集中化。
4. 可视化与洞察:为运维与合规提供链上/链下混合分析仪表盘,支持审核与取证。
六、可追溯性设计
1. 可审计日志:对关键事件(助记词导入导出、交易签名、权限变更)保持不可篡改的审核链,采用签名时间戳或叠加链上记录。
2. 可验证性:使用 Merkle 树、存证服务或 IPFS + 可验证证明保存重要快照,便于事后审计与合规检查。
3. 分级访问与隐私:对审计数据做分级授权,确保合规透明同时保护用户隐私。
七、矿池相关考量
(若钱包涉及矿池或挖矿管理)
1. 协议与接口:支持标准 Stratum 或池 API,安全管理池凭证与 worker 名称,避免凭证泄露导致盗挖/盗币。
2. 收益分配与证明:提供透明的收益计算、支付周期、支付门槛,并支持支付单据与 Merkle 证明以验证收入。
3. 风险控制:监控算力异常、池端伪造收益、前端恶意配置(矿池被替换),引入多签或白名单矿池策略。
4. 合规与税务:挖矿收益上链或记录,满足不同地区税务与合规要求。
八、优先级建议与路线图
1. 立刻项:关键安全修复(密钥存储、依赖升级、远程更新签名);上线紧急赏金计划。
2. 中期项(3-6 个月):模块化重构、多链适配器、后台风控与审计日志实现。
3. 长期项:开放 SDK 与生态伙伴计划、智能化风控与隐私保护的联邦学习平台、矿池透明化与合规工具。
九、结语
老版 TPWallet 的价值在于既有用户基础与实践经验,但也存在现代钱包面临的典型风险与扩展挑战。通过系统的代码审计、模块化演进、全球化合规与智能化数据能力建设,并结合可追溯性与矿池安全策略,TPWallet 可在确保安全的基础上实现可持续且合规的全球扩张。
评论
SkyWalker
很全面的分析,尤其是对密钥管理和更新签名的建议很实用。
小白兔
关于矿池部分的风险控制讲得很好,建议补充下对合并挖矿的支持设计。
TechSage
赞同模块化和开源策略,能大幅降低供应链风险并促进生态合作。
张三
可追溯性那块很重要,特别是审计日志和 Merkle 存证,值得优先实现。
Luna
智能化风控与隐私保护并行的思路很好,联邦学习是个可行方向。